Cleveland Browns Unveil $2.4 Billion Domed Stadium Financing Plans for Brook Park

The Haslam Sports Group has proposed a financing model to fund a new enclosed Huntington Bank Field, revealing a plan for a $2.4 billion Cleveland Browns domed stadium in Brook Park. The Browns ownership is advocating for a 50/50 public-private funding approach, seeking $1.2 billion in public financing. Public discussions around the financing have begun, with Cuyahoga County officials expressing skepticism about the viability of the plan. Ohio Governor Mike DeWine is looking to increase taxes on sports betting to help fund the stadium and has introduced a proposal to double the state tax on sportsbooks. Despite concerns from local residents about the impact on eastern suburb fans, the Browns are confident that a new stadium could open doors for significant events like a Super Bowl in the future.
